A U.S. court has ruled that a vaccination for certain childhood diseases is not linked to autism, as claimed by parents of children who suffer from the brain disorder. The ruling Thursday is a blow to at least 4,800 families who have filed similar claims and are seeking compensation through the government’s “Vaccine Injury Compensation Program.” VOA.com also reports:

The special court in Washington ruled Thursday against the parents of three children, saying the families had failed to prove their claims. In his decision, the special master, George L. Hastings Jr., ruled that the government’s medical expert witnesses were “far better qualified, far more experienced and far more persuasive” than the Cedillos’. Although the family had to show only that the preponderance of evidence was on their side, Mr. Hastings ruled that the evidence was “overwhelmingly contrary” to their argument.
